Qualified teachers employed in a maintained school, a non-maintained special school or a pupil referral unit must be registered with the GTC.
This application form explains the registration process.
To be eligible for full registration:
- you need to hold Qualified Teacher Status (QTS)
- you must not be barred/restricted from teaching by the ISA or GTC
- you must not have failed to complete an induction period satisfactorily; and
- you will need to meet the GTC suitability criteria.
The fee year runs from 1 April to 31 March each year, and the registration fee from 1 April 2010 is £36.50.
Overseas trained teachers (OTTs) and instructors applying for provisional registration must use a different application form.
